Sarah performs an experiment to determine the effect of nitrogen on plants. She studies the effect of nitrogen on the growth of

the root hair, height of the plants, and nodule formation. Which factor is an independent variable?
a) Amount of Nitrogen
b) Growth of Root Hair
c) Nodule Formation
d) Height of the Plants
Biology
2 answers:
zysi [14]4 years ago
6 0

The correct answer is option a) Amount of Nitrogen.

The variables are the factors, which can be changed in an experiment. The variables can be of two types, dependent variable and independent variable.

The independent variables are those factors, which are independent of any changes. In this case, the amount of nitrogen Sarah administer is not dependent on any factor, so, it is an independent variable.

Whereas, the height of plant, nodules and root growth is dependent on the amount of nitrogen the plant get. SO, these are dependent variables.
